Board schedules public hearing on a 5.23-acre lot-line transfer; applicant told to reconcile EAF numbers

Cornwall Planning Board · August 6, 2026

Summary

A proposed lot-line amendment transferring 5.23 acres to an existing lot was presented; town reviewers said the EAF lists inconsistent acreage (5.85 vs 5.23) and that the application requires a public hearing; the board scheduled the hearing and authorized referral to the ZBA if lot-width calculations require a variance.

An applicant presented a lot-line amendment transferring approximately 5.23 acres from a vacant parcel to an adjacent residential lot. The town’s technical review found the EAF lists the transferred area as 5.85 acres in one place and asked the applicant to correct the inconsistency and to show the approximate septic location and well status. The board scheduled a public hearing and, to save time if needed, authorized referral to the Zoning Board of Appeals should subsequent lot-width calculations show a variance is required.

Town staff advised the application is a Type II action under SECRA as presented and that no county referral was required based on location, but that public notice and a public hearing are required by the town code for lot-line changes.
